...small but determined group of demonstrators stood in the rain outside the Harvard Faculty Club Saturday afternoon to protest a conference on El Salvador at which Rene Leon, the Salvadoran ambassador to the U.S., was speaking. The sound of cars on the wet pavement of Quincy Street mingled with the chanting of the Boston branch of the national Committee in Solidarity with the People of El Salvador (CISPES).
